Clock IC optimizes JESD204B serial interface functionality.
Clock Generators

Clock IC optimizes JESD204B serial interface functionality.

Intended for GSPS data converter applications, Model AD9528 delivers low-power, multi-output, clock distribution function with low-jitter performance, along with on-chip, 2-stage PLL and VCO. Device provides JESD204B-compatible subclass 1 SYSREF and deterministic latency clocking signals and supports options for SYSREF signal generation. Clock Generators

Clock Generators suit networking and storage applications.

Supplied in 5 x 5 mm package, Models ZL30250 and ZL30251 offer ultra-low jitter of 160 fs and any-to-any frequency conversion with 0 ppm error. Generators feature up to 3 differential outputs, up to 6 CMOS outputs, and 3 universal clock inputs that connect to any signal format at any voltage.
